The Importance of Door Maintenance: A Comprehensive Guide

Doors are often neglected when it comes to home maintenance, yet they play a crucial function in the functionality, security, and aesthetic appeals of a property. Routine door maintenance ensures that they run efficiently, last longer, and keep their look. This short article looks into the necessary aspects of door maintenance, providing practical ideas and insights to help homeowners keep their doors in leading condition.

Why Door Maintenance Matters

  1. Safety and Security: Well-maintained doors are less most likely to fail during emergency situations and supply much better security versus trespassers.
  2. Energy Efficiency: Properly sealed and aligned doors prevent drafts, minimizing cooling and heating costs.
  3. Aesthetics: Regular maintenance helps maintain the door's look, boosting the general look of the home.
  4. Durability: Proper care extends the life expectancy of doors, conserving money on replacements.

Common Issues and Solutions

  1. Sticking or Binding Doors

    • Causes: Warping, humidity changes, or loose hinges.
    • Solutions: Adjust hinges, sand down the door, or use a lubricant.
  2. Drafts and Leaks

    • Causes: Worn weatherstripping, gaps, or damaged seals.
    • Solutions: Replace weatherstripping, apply caulk, or install door sweeps.
  3. Creaking Hinges

    • Causes: Dry or rusty hinges.
    • Solutions: Lubricate hinges with a silicone-based lube or oil.
  4. Lock Malfunctions

    • Causes: Worn mechanisms, dirt, or particles.
    • Solutions: Clean the lock, lube moving parts, or replace the lock if needed.

Step-by-Step Maintenance Guide

  1. Inspect the Door and Frame

    • Examine for Warping: Look for spaces or irregular surfaces.
    • Take a look at the Frame: Ensure it is securely connected and devoid of rot or damage.
    • Check the Threshold: Replace if it is damaged or worn.
  2. Tidy the Door

    • Remove Dirt and Debris: Use a soft fabric or sponge with mild soap and water.
    • Tidy the Glass: Use a glass cleaner and a lint-free fabric.
    • Clean Down the Hardware: Clean deals with, knobs, and hinges to avoid accumulation.
  3. Lube Moving Parts

    • Hinges: Apply a silicone-based lubricant or oil.
    • Locks: Use a graphite powder or silicone spray.
    • Rollers and Sliding Mechanisms: Lubricate to guarantee smooth operation.
  4. Examine and Replace Weatherstripping

    • Inspect for Wear: Look for spaces or damage.
    • Measure and Cut: Use an energy knife to cut new weatherstripping to fit.
    • Install: Press the new weatherstripping into place, ensuring it is tight and secure.
  5. Tighten up Hardware

    • Hinges: Tighten screws to guarantee the door hangs correctly.
    • Manages and Knobs: Check for loose screws and tighten as required.
    • Locks: Ensure all parts are safely attached.
  6. Adjust the Door

    • Alignment: Use a level to examine if the door is plumb.
    • Hinge Adjustment: Loosen or tighten hinge screws to align the door.
    • Threshold Adjustment: Raise or reduce the threshold to make sure a proper seal.

Seasonal Maintenance Tips

  1. Spring and Summer

    • Look for Warping: High humidity can cause doors to warp. Change as needed.
    • Examine Weatherstripping: Replace any used or damaged strips.
    • Clean and Lubricate: Remove dirt and use lubricant to moving parts.
  2. Fall and Winter

    • Seal Gaps: Apply caulk or weatherstripping to avoid drafts.
    • Lubricate Locks: Prevent freezing by lubricating with a silicone-based item.
    • Examine for Damage: Check for any indications of wear or damage due to weather.

FAQs

Q: How often should I check and keep my doors?

  • A: It is advised to examine and keep your doors a minimum of two times a year, ideally in the spring and fall. However, more regular checks may be necessary for high-traffic areas or severe weather.

Q: Can I use WD-40 to oil my door hinges?

  • A: While WD-40 can be used in a pinch, it is not the very best choice for long-term lubrication. Silicone-based lubes or oils are more effective and longer-lasting.

Q: What should I do if my door is warped?

  • A: For minor warping, you can try adjusting the hinges or shimming the door. For serious warping, it might be needed to replace the door.

Q: How do I understand if my weatherstripping requires to be replaced?

  • A: If you can feel a draft, see light around the door, or discover the weatherstripping is used, split, or damaged, it is time to change it.
